It seems to be about breaking out of the cycle of illusion. You must stay away from the darkness (ignorance) to see the shooting star (knowledge). Following your beacon out of our universe and through the cold that numbs your memory away, you find yourself cleansed of ego and memory.
On the other side, you send a sign to yourself (the shooting star) and you reconcile these two realities.
In the beginning you must let go In order to follow your star, in the end you must hold on, thus reconciling the two realities. The paradox.

it's about the breaking out of the past. The shooting star symbolises the ought to march on forward.
"departure has arrived, don't look back." "avoid the darkness, stay away, stay out of sight
until you feel the blast of a shooting star"
It simply means that you have to stay in tact with reality and don't fall into the hole of hopelessness and depression, and hold on until the strenght to let go finally gets you moving on again.
"don't fear the cold, it'll numb your memories out" reflects on that once he has moved on and doesn't think about it, he'll forget it eventually.
"and if you hold the truth within your hands
you won't be sent back through the rain, reborn"
is that as long as he stays true and logical to himself, he will be able to live his life without any severe oppressing misery.
